IUBMB Enzyme Nomenclature

EC 3.1.1.26

Accepted name: galactolipase

Reaction: 1,2-diacyl-3-β-D-galactosyl-sn-glycerol + 2 H2O = 3-β-D-galactosyl-sn-glycerol + 2 carboxylates

Other name(s): galactolipid lipase; polygalactolipase; galactolipid acylhydrolase

Systematic name: 1,2-diacyl-3-β-D-galactosyl-sn-glycerol acylhydrolase

Comments: Also acts on 2,3-di-O-acyl-1-O-(6-O-α-D-galactosyl-β-D-galactosyl)-D-glycerol, and phosphatidylcholine and other phospholipids.
